Output 93a866dc4430a37633b4d5d856667f9722bf30bb41bfc4e8ff6ff6ba696aedd0:0

value
183550806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99164136639e8c9bee176c10b3e1826fa19cc223 OP_EQUAL
address
3FeTyBPirHvMssrn3gKUtsABQg8hEsfHcz
transaction
93a866dc4430a37633b4d5d856667f9722bf30bb41bfc4e8ff6ff6ba696aedd0
confirmations
117048
spent
true